Standard Measurements For Electric Guitar Bodies

Most electric guitars on the market fall within a certain range regarding body thickness. Typically, solid-body guitars measure between 1.5 to 2 inches (38 to 50 mm). Variations depend on the make and model, as well as the presence of any contouring or cutaways that contribute to playability.

Comparing Thickness Across Different Guitar Models

  • Fender Stratocaster – Known for its comfort and balanced tones, it typically has a body thickness of around 1.75 inches (44.45 mm).
  • Gibson Les Paul – Renowned for its rich sustain and thick sound, it usually boasts a thicker body, around 1.875 to 2 inches (47.62 to 50.8 mm).
  • Ibanez RG Series – Designed for precision and speed, these guitars often feature a slimmer profile, approximately 1.65 to 1.7 inches (42 to 43 mm).

These variations reflect the diversity of sound qualities and physical characteristics desired by different players, offering a range of options to cater to various musical demands and playing styles.

Material And Wood Type Considerations

The material chosen for an electric guitar’s body is foundational in determining its thickness. Different woods carry distinct densities and acoustic properties, influencing the final measurement. For instance:

  • Mahogany, known for its warmth and sustain, may require added thickness to counteract its heaviness and enhance resonance.
  • Alder and ash, popular for their balanced tones, allow for moderate thickness while maintaining a comfortable weight.
  • Basswood is often used in slimmer profiles due to its light weight and neutral tone.

Designers must balance the natural characteristics of the wood with the guitar’s desired sonic and physical attributes.

Impact Of Manufacturing Processes And Techniques

Modern manufacturing processes can significantly influence the final body thickness of an electric guitar. Advanced techniques such as:

  • CNC machining allow for precise control over the guitar’s contours and can achieve thinner bodies without sacrificing structural integrity.
  • Chambering, where sections of the guitar body are hollowed out, may result in a lighter instrument with varying thickness across its surface.

Each method presents opportunities and challenges, as manufacturers strive for the perfect harmony between durability, weight, and tonality.

Physical Comfort And Ergonomics For Players

Playing comfort is paramount, and body thickness directly impacts a guitarist’s physical interaction with the instrument. A slimmer profile may offer easier access for playing higher frets and reduced weight, leading to less shoulder strain during extended sessions. On the other hand, some players prefer the substantial feel of thicker bodies, equating the heft with a sense of durability and quality.

Ergonomic considerations also play a role; with manufacturers designing contoured bodies that marry optimal thickness with comfortable playability. Here are key ergonomic factors influenced by body thickness:

  1. Weight distribution
  2. Balanced positioning, both standing and seated
  3. Accessibility to the upper frets

Frequently Asked Questions Of How Thick Are Electric Guitar Bodies

How Thick Is A Standard Telecaster Body?

A standard Telecaster body typically has a thickness of about 1. 75 inches (44. 45mm). This dimension is crucial for the guitar’s classic tone and balance.

What Is The Minimum Thickness For An Electric Guitar?

The minimum thickness for an electric guitar typically ranges from 1. 5 to 2 inches to ensure optimal sound and playability.

How Thick Is A Guitar Body In Mm?

The typical thickness of an electric guitar body ranges from 40mm to 45mm. Acoustic guitars usually have a body thickness from 90mm to 100mm.
